You do not need to be a plumbing expert. <\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Showers to You<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> will show you how to stop the toilet running today.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><strong>Why Your Toilet Cistern Keeps Running<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Understanding your plumbing helps you fix a running toilet cistern. The cistern holds water until you press the flush button. Water then flows into the bowl to clear waste. A fill valve allows water to refill the tank. A flush valve seals the water inside the tank. If either valve breaks, the toilet keeps running. <\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">This<\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> means water continuously flows down into the bowl. A toilet <\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">won\u2019t<\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> stop filling if parts are broken.<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-medium wp-image-4815\" src=\"https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-300x300.jpg\" alt=\"Flushing Toilet\" width=\"300\" height=\"300\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-1024x1024.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-768x768.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-1536x1536.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-40x40.jpg 40w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et-650x650.jpg 650w, https:\/\/www.showerstoyou.co.uk\/latest\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/Flushing-Toilet.jpg 2000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/span><\/p>\n<h2><strong>Symptoms of a Running Toilet:<\/strong><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Constant hissing<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Water trickling into bowl<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Tank refilling repeatedly<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Movement in overflow tube<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><strong>Common Causes of a Running Toilet<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Several issues can cause a running toilet cistern. The most frequent culprit is a faulty fill valve. This part controls the water entering your tank. If it breaks, water flows into the toilet cistern overflow. Another common issue is a leaking flush valve. This rubber seal can degrade over time. When it degrades, water leaks directly into the toilet bowl. Debris inside the tank can also block these valves. Sometimes, the dual flush buttons get stuck or misaligned.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><strong>How to Fix a Running Toilet Step by Step<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><strong>What You Need<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Adjustable wrench<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Sponge<\/span><\/li>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Replacement fill valve<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><strong>Repair Time<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">15\u201330 minutes<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><strong>Difficulty<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Beginner DIY<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Follow these steps for your UK toilet plumbing repair.<\/span><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">First, turn off the water supply to the toilet. If the toilet <\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">won\u2019t<\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> stop filling, replace the parts.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><strong>When to Replace the Fill Valve<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Sometimes a simple cleaning will not stop the leak. You must replace a faulty fill valve if it breaks. If water pours into the toilet cistern overflow, replace it. You can buy replacement parts from most DIY stores. Fitting a new valve is a simple toilet cistern repair. Follow the manufacturer&#8217;s instructions carefully to avoid further leaks.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">If you want a new system, consider an upgrade. Underside of lid catches on the mechanism so the cistern keeps filling.&#8221;<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><strong>How Much Water a Running Toilet Wastes<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">A running toilet cistern is bad for the environment. According to <\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.yorkshirewater.com\/news-media\/news-articles\/2025\/a-leaky-loo-could-be-wasting-double-your-average-daily-water-usage\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Yorkshire Water<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">, a leaking toilet can waste up to 400 litres of water per day. <\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">This<\/span><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\"> can add hundreds of pounds to annual bills. You must fix a running toilet as soon as possible. Water conservation is incredibly important for UK households today.
